Oct. 15, 2009 (PR Newswire) -- CANTON, Mass., Oct. 15 /PRNewswire/ -- CrossTech Forums LLC (www.crosstechforums.com), a leader in the hosted executive conference market, today announced the winners of the 2009 Financial Technology Insight Summit Awards (www.FinancialTechnologyInsight.com). The nominations for these awards are made by the participating technology buyers and end users, primarily director-level and above in technology management positions at top global banks and other financial institutions -- the ultimate in Customer Choice Awards. The Financial Technology Insight conference program agenda is developed in conjunction with IDC Financial Insights, the global advisory services and market research firm.
Financial Technology Insight Summit is a two-day, invitation-only educational and networking program with structured attendee/sponsor interaction. Participants are guided through the program with case study presentations, one-on-one vendor and industry analyst meetings, solutions panels, and World Premiere Keynotes. The voting takes place on the final day of the program and is based on solutions and product knowledge gained throughout the various educational programs.
Best Market Solution:
-- Nominees: Continuity Engines, Fiserv, Lexmark International, Virtual
Banking Systems
-- Winner: Virtual Banking Systems
Best New Technology:
-- Nominees: Continuity Engines, PROMT, UCS Group - Romania, Fiserv,
Virtual Banking Systems
-- Winner: PROMT
Best Value for Money/ROI:
-- Nominees: CPM Braxis, Continuity Engines, ECCOX Software, IBM, Kaplan
Compliance, Tata Consulting Services
-- Winner: Continuity Engines
Most Innovative Case Study Presentation:
-- Nominees: Fiserv, Harland Financial Solutions, IBM, Infosys Technologies
Limited, Virtual Banking Systems, UCS Group - Romania
-- Winner: Fiserv
Best Overall Vendor:
-- Nominees: Brazil IT, Continuity Engines, ECCOX, Fiserv, Harland
Financial Solutions, IBM, PROMT, Virtual Banking Systems
-- Winner: IBM
